Britain’s royal train service has been deemed too expensive, so now it’s being ditched in favor of helicopters and scheduled rail journeys. Not everyone is happy about it.
The royal train has also been part of King Charles’s life. He was photographed riding it as a young boy, and he used it in 1981 to depart for his honeymoon with Diana, Princess of Wales.
